What is SCG Decor PCL Capex-to-Operating-Cash-Flow?

Capex-to-Operating-Cash-Flow assesses how much of a company’s cash flow from operations is being devoted to capital expenditure. It’s also useful to distinguish whether the company is capital intensive or not.

SCG Decor PCL's Capital Expenditure for the three months ended in Mar. 2024 was ฿-403.65 Mil. Its Cash Flow from Operations for the three months ended in Mar. 2024 was ฿627.15 Mil.

Hence, SCG Decor PCL's Capex-to-Operating-Cash-Flow for the three months ended in Mar. 2024 was 0.64.

SCG Decor PCL Capex-to-Operating-Cash-Flow Calculation

SCG Decor PCL's Capex-to-Operating-Cash-Flow for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Capex-to-Operating-Cash-Flow=- Capital Expenditure / Cash Flow from Operations
=- (-1742.361) / 3494.375
=0.50

SCG Decor PCL's Capex-to-Operating-Cash-Flow for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2024 is calculated as

Capex-to-Operating-Cash-Flow=- Capital Expenditure / Cash Flow from Operations
=- (-403.652) / 627.146
=0.64

SCG Decor PCL  (BKK:SCGD-F) Capex-to-Operating-Cash-Flow Explanation

Capex-to-Operating-Cash-Flow ratio assesses how much of a company’s Cash Flow from Operations is being devoted to Capital Expenditure. It is a good indicator in terms of how much the company is focused on growth. In general, a high Capex-to-Operating-Cash-Flow ratio indicates that the company is investing more in physical assets and is focused on growth and expansion. Conversely, lower ratio could indicate that a company has reached maturity and is no longer pursuing aggressive growth.

Moreover, the ratio is also useful to distinguish whether the company is capital intensive or not. If the ratio is large, then the company tends to be capital intensive. Lower ratio suggests that it’s a capital-light business. The ratio can be combined with ROIC % to identify whether the company is an asset-light business that has a high return on invested capital. This is one question investors commonly ask to see if a company qualifies as a good company.

SCG Decor PCL operates as a holding company in which its subsidiaries and associates operate business as manufacturers of Floor tiles and wall tiles in Thailand and other countries such as Vietnam, It consists of two segments namely Decor Surfaces Business, which derives the maximum revenue and Bathroom Business. Geographically, it generates majority revenue from Thailand.
